According to Census 2011 information the location code or village code of Baratapali village is 434466. Baratapali village is located in Udaipur tehsil of Raigarh district in Chhattisgarh, India. It is situated 15km away from sub-district headquarter Dharamjaigarh (tehsildar office) and 60km away from district headquarter Raigarh. As per 2009 stats, Bartapali is the gram panchayat of Baratapali village.
The total geographical area of village is 1579.79 hectares. Baratapali has a total population of 1,488 peoples, out of which male population is 731 while female population is 757. This results in a sex ratio of approximately 1035 females for every 1,000 males. Literacy rate of baratapali village is 45.43% out of which 54.99% males and 36.20% females are literate. There are about 365 houses in baratapali village. Pincode of baratapali village locality is 496116.
When it comes to administration, Baratapali village is governed by a Sarpanch, who is an elected representative (Head of Village) chosen through local elections, as per the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. As per 2019 stats, Baratapali village comes under Dharamjaigarh Vidhan Sabha constituency & Raigarh Lok Sabha constituency. Dharamjaigarh is nearest town to baratapali village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 15km away.
